Primary Responsibilities

Complete intake on new features, identifying the value they add to the product.

Develop and maintain a product roadmap that aligns with business objectives and user needs.

Work with partners and stakeholders to define high-level user stories and designs for handover to the delivery team once aligned to a sprint.

Align with consumer insights to conduct market research to identify user needs and industry trends that inform product development.

Understand current product performance by analyzing reports, customer feedback, and other insights to inform leadership on performance to plan.

Prepare for and participate in agile ceremonies, including daily stand‑up, quarterly planning, sprint planning, and retrospectives.

Ensure the Product Owner and delivery team are developing and implementing solutions that meet business and user needs.

Facilitate the resolution of conflicts and impediments faced by the delivery team.

Minimum Qualifications

Ability to articulate product vision and requirements clearly.

Strong analytical skills to assess performance metrics and user feedback.

Proficiency in agile methodologies and experience with product management tools.

Excellent communication and collaboration skills for engaging with stakeholders and cross-functional teams.

Problem‑solving skills to address conflicts and impediments.

Understanding of UX and design principles to guide feature development.

Organizational skills to manage multiple priorities and projects effectively.
